Curvelet Approach for SAR Image Denoising, Structure Enhancement, and Change Detection [PDF]

open access: yes, 2009
In this paper we present an alternative method for SAR image denoising, structure enhancement, and change detection based on the curvelet transform. Curvelets can be denoted as a two dimensional further development of the well-known wavelets.

Implicit Neural Representations for Unsupervised Seismic Data Interpolation From Single Gather

open access: yesGeophysical Prospecting, Volume 73, Issue 9, November 2025.
ABSTRACT Missing seismic traces from data acquisition limits often significantly degrade data quality. This study presents an unsupervised method using implicit neural representation (INR), specifically sinusoidal representation network (SIREN), to enhance seismic data quality from a single shot gather.
